Good afternoon
I need to sort this filter as follows:
1. <1M€
2. 1M€ to 5M€
3. 5M€ to 10M€
4. 10M€ to 20M€
5. 20Me a 40M€
6. >40M€
Thank you very much in advance and greetings!
Hello @Syndicate_Admin ,
Add a sorting column that has numbers for sorting which one is before the other, and then sort the main column with this sorting column.
